[PATCH v2 net-next] net: link_watch: prevent starvation when processing linkwatch wq

From: Yunsheng Lin
Date: Fri May 31 2019 - 05:05:16 EST


When user has configured a large number of virtual netdev, such
as 4K vlans, the carrier on/off operation of the real netdev
will also cause it's virtual netdev's link state to be processed
in linkwatch. Currently, the processing is done in a work queue,
which may cause cpu and rtnl locking starvation problem.

This patch releases the cpu and rtnl lock when link watch worker
has processed a fixed number of netdev' link watch event.

Currently __linkwatch_run_queue is called with rtnl lock, so
enfore it with ASSERT_RTNL();

V2: use cond_resched and rtnl_unlock after processing a fixed
number of events
---
net/core/link_watch.c | 17 +++++++++++++++++
1 file changed, 17 insertions(+)

diff --git a/net/core/link_watch.c b/net/core/link_watch.c
index 7f51efb..07eebfb 100644
--- a/net/core/link_watch.c
+++ b/net/core/link_watch.c
@@ -168,9 +168,18 @@ static void linkwatch_do_dev(struct net_device *dev)

static void __linkwatch_run_queue(int urgent_only)
{
+#define MAX_DO_DEV_PER_LOOP 100
+
+ int do_dev = MAX_DO_DEV_PER_LOOP;
struct net_device *dev;
LIST_HEAD(wrk);

+ ASSERT_RTNL();
+
+ /* Give urgent case more budget */
+ if (urgent_only)
+ do_dev += MAX_DO_DEV_PER_LOOP;
+
/*
* Limit the number of linkwatch events to one
* per second so that a runaway driver does not
@@ -200,6 +209,14 @@ static void __linkwatch_run_queue(int urgent_only)
}
spin_unlock_irq(&lweventlist_lock);
linkwatch_do_dev(dev);
+
+ if (--do_dev < 0) {
+ rtnl_unlock();
+ cond_resched();
+ do_dev = MAX_DO_DEV_PER_LOOP;
+ rtnl_lock();
+ }
+
spin_lock_irq(&lweventlist_lock);
}
